NAME Cahuitamycin A
FORMULA C27H37N7O11
MOLECULAR WEIGHT (Da) 635.6310
ACCURATE MASS (Da) 635.2551
ORIGIN ORGANISM TYPE Bacterium
ORIGIN GENUS Streptomyces
ORIGIN SPECIES gandocaensis
InChIKey HAEVQUMQPJTONP-FUMNGEBKSA-N
InChI InChI=1S/C27H37N7O11/c35-13-18(31-24(41)19-14-45-26(32-19)16-5-1-2-8-21(16)37)23(40)30-17(6-4-12-33(44)15-36)27(43)34-20(7-3-10-29-34)25(42)28-11-9-22(38)39/h1-2,5,8,15,17-20,29,35,37,44H,3-4,6-7,9-14H2,(H,28,42)(H,30,40)(H,31,41)(H,38,39)/t17-,18+,19+,20-/m1/s1
SMILES O=CN(O)CCC[C@@H](NC(=O)[C@H](CO)NC(=O)[C@@H]1COC(C2=CC=CC=C2O)=N1)C(=O)N1NCCC[C@@H]1C(=O)NCCC(=O)O
ORIGINAL ISOLATION REFERENCE
CITATION Park, SR; Tripathi, A; Wu, J; Schultz, PJ; Yim, I; McQuade, TJ; Yu, F; Arevang, CJ; Mensah, AY; Tamayo-Castillo, G; Xi, C; Sherman, DH Discovery of cahuitamycins as biofilm inhibitors derived from a convergent biosynthetic pathway. Nature Communications 2016 7 10710.
DOI 10.1038/ncomms10710 PMID 26880271
